Project Accountant – Construction General Contractor

Office located in the Ocoee / Apopka area (Central Florida)

We are a trusted, relationship-driven Central Florida General Contractor delivering commercial new construction and renovation projects. We’re seeking a Construction Project Accountant to oversee projects from a financial and compliance perspective—supporting job cost, draws, billing, and subcontractor payment cycles from start to finish.

What You’ll Do

  • Input and track all job-cost related payables and project expenses
  • Review and enter Subcontractor Pay Applications and Schedules of Values (SOVs)
  • Prepare monthly Owner draws and related SOVs
  • Post cash receipts and cash applications
  • Maintain Notice to Owner (NTO) documentation and lien releases
  • Support Project Managers with monthly cost reporting and forecasting accuracy
  • Analyze job performance weekly to ensure cost coding and projections are correct
  • Collaborate with PMs, vendors, subs, clients, and governmental agencies with professionalism and diplomacy
  • Prepare special accounting reports and support project audits and financial tracking
  • Participate in monthly project review meetings to improve efficiency, profitability, and client satisfaction
